The Beginings of a Jon Boat Conversion
shadeofgrey1031 theres alot of great advice here suggesting what you can and cant do to a 10ftr and I know this all first hand. A 10ftr is a nice craft to get you into fish, but has its limits. Seriously check the plate and boats capacity like stated, that motor and battery is going to add close to 100lbs right there, toss in you and a buddy at 150 to 175 and your in the 400 range. If I was going to do it over, I wouldnt do it to a 10ftr. jus my .02cents.

Looking to Get Some new stuff.
I'd suggest spinning gear also, and agree with RW, a medium rod with extra fast tip will offer plenty to cover all bases on what your goals are. I myself like the xf tips, you'll feel every subtle lil tap. With names like Powell, GLoomis, St Croix, Shimano and my personal favorite a custom rod from GBlanks, all offer excellent choices for $200 and under. Spinning reels can be a dime a dozen so choose wisely, a $100 to $125 reel will provide you with years of service when properly taken care of. Simano, Abu Garcia and my choice Daiwa all offer great reels. To pair it up with a 6 or 6.6 rod a 2500 series reel would be perfect, look at the Daiwa Tierra 2500, you can score them on ebay for under $110 shipped, if you can ante up a few more bux, the Daiwa Fuego can be had for like $150, the all red body. All in all if you look around you'll find grrrreat deals in the flea market here and 99% of these guys are trustworthy, I've bought and sold with great success. Good Luck
